The most gold medals won at the International Judo Federation World Judo Masters is four, achieved by Dorjsürengiin Sumiyaa (Mongolia; 2013 and 2015–17), Kim Polling (Netherlands; 2013, 2015–16 and 2019), Teddy Riner (France, 2010–11, 2015 and 2021), Miku Takaichi (Japan; 2015–17 and 2022) and Distria Krasniqi (Kosovo; 2018–19 and 2021–22).
First staged in 2010, the IJF World Masters is an invite-only annual competition.
